Employee and Employer Contribution Divisions
With 401(k) profit sharing plans, there may be both employee salary deferral contributions and employer profit sharing contributions. QDROs need to specify how these are divided:
- You can split the balance by percentage (e.g., 50%) or fixed dollar amount (e.g., $100,000).
- Typically, both employee and employer contributions are subject to division, depending on what is available and vested on the date chosen for division (usually the date of separation or divorce).
